Based in Sydney, Australia, GiggedIn is a live music subscription platform established in 2016 by founder Edwin Onggo that provides members with guest list access to concerts, DJ sets, and festivals. Operating on a tiered monthly membership model ranging from $15 to $70, the company allows users to RSVP to available shows without paying individual ticket fees. By securing ticket allocations directly from promoters and venues, the service helps fill excess capacity across the live entertainment industry, including partnerships with events like COSMOS. The enterprise has generated over $1.5 million in revenue and facilitated over 30,000 member attendances across 3,500 events in the Sydney and Melbourne markets while securing $1.3 million in total funding. Originally launched as a crowdfunding platform before pivoting to its current model, the firm plans to expand into Brisbane by early 2027.
